The Wealth Gap Between Renters and Homeowners

You may be surprised to learn that the average homeowner’s net worth is 40 times higher than that of a renter. This staggering difference comes down to one key factor: equity. When you rent, your monthly payments go toward someone else’s mortgage, building their wealth while you receive nothing in return for your financial future. In contrast, homeownership builds your own equity, turning a monthly expense into a wealth-building tool.


In fact, two-thirds of the average person’s net worth is tied to their home equity according to sources on MBS Highway. That means homeownership isn't just about providing a place to live—it's a critical step toward financial security and long-term wealth creation.


Why Home Values Matter

Not only does homeownership build equity over time, but it also benefits from the natural appreciation of property values. Recent data from the Case-Shiller Index reports that national home prices saw an annual gain of 5.4% in June, hitting another all-time high.


What does this mean for you as a potential homeowner? Each year, home values have the potential to increase, so does the value of your investment. By owning a home, you're not just making monthly payments—you're watching your wealth grow.

If you're planning to buy a home in Washington State in 2025, understanding loan limits is a key step in navigating your mortgage options. Loan limits define the maximum amount you can borrow with a conforming loan—those backed by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ac—before you enter "jumbo" loan territory, which often comes with stricter requirements and higher interest rates. These limits vary by county, reflecting differences in local housing markets, with some areas designated as "high balance" due to elevated home prices.
